8. And of the Gadites there separated themselves unto David in the fortress in the wilderness, men of might of war fit for the battle, put in order with shield and buckler, whose faces were like the faces of lions and were as swift as the roes upon the mountains;

9. Ezer, the chief, Obadiah, the second, Eliab, the third,

10. Mishmannah, the fourth, Jeremiah, the fifth,

11. Attai, the sixth, Eliel, the seventh,

12. Johanan, the eighth, Elzabad, the ninth,

13. Jeremiah, the tenth, Machbanai, the eleventh.

14. These were of the sons of Gad, captains of the host. One of the least was over one hundred men, and the greatest over a thousand.

15. These went over the Jordan in the first month, when it had overflown all its banks, and they put to flight all those of the valleys to the east and to the west.

16. Likewise, some of the sons of Benjamin and Judah came to David, to the fortress.

17. And David went out to meet them and answered and said unto them, If you are come peaceably unto me to help me, my heart shall be knit unto you; but if you are come to betray me to my enemies, seeing there is no violence in my hands, let the God of our fathers look thereon and rebuke it.

18. Then the spirit clothed himself in Amasai, who was chief of the thirty, and he said, For thee, O David, and with thee, thou son of Jesse. Peace, peace be unto thee, and peace be to thy helpers; for thy God helps thee. Then David received them and put them among the captains of the band.

19. And some of Manasseh passed over to David, when he came with the Philistines against Saul to battle, although they did not help them, for the cardinals of the Philistines, upon counsel, sent him away, saying, He will pass over to his master Saul with our heads.

20. As he went to Ziklag, there passed over to him of Manasseh, Adnah, Jozabad, Jediael, Michael, Jozabad, Elihu, and Zilthai, heads of the thousands that were of Manasseh.

21. And they helped David with a band; for they were all mighty men of valour and were captains in the host.

22. For at that time help came every day to David until it was a great camp, like the camp of God.
